Salisbury was a city in southwestern England.

In 1963, Alistair Gordon Lethbridge-Stewart was on manoeuvres at Salisbury. The Eleventh Doctor borrowed his identity and called himself "colonel". (PROSE: Shroud of Sorrow)

English Army Strategic Command was located 4 kilometres northwest of Salisbury in Wiltshire. (PROSE: The Forgotten Son) Cloots Coombe was a small village in the same area. (AUDIO: Comeback)

After the 22nd century Dalek invasion, England was broken into Domains, including London, Canterbury, Devon and Salisbury. (PROSE: Legacy of the Daleks)
